Laravel Back-end Developer
Job Description
- Strong understanding of PHP: This is the foundation for Laravel development.
- Laravel Framework: Proficiency in Laravel concepts like MVC architecture, Blade templating, Eloquent ORM, artisan commands, and security features.
- SQL Databases: Experience working with relational databases, primarily MySQL, for data storage and retrieval using Laravel’s Eloquent ORM.
- HTML, CSS, and Javascript: Basic understanding of front-end technologies for working with Laravel views and integrating with frontend frameworks.
- Unit Testing: Knowledge of unit testing frameworks like PHPUnit to write unit tests for Laravel code.
- Version Control: Experience using Git for version control and collaboration.
- RESTful APIs: Ability to design and build RESTful APIs using Laravel features.
- Soft Skills: Excellent communication, problem-solving, and teamwork skills.
Requirements
- Candidates should possess Bachelor’s Degrees with 2 – 3 years relevant work experience.
- Knowledge of Software Methodologies
- Hardcore knowledge of programming in PHP (using Laravel framework) Preference will be given to candidates who can prove their expertise in developing real-life systems and applications with the language Hardcore knowledge of Relational Database Management System, such as Microsoft SQL Server, MySQL, etc.
- Knowledge of Object-Oriented Programming. All codes must be written in OOP Knowledge of AJAX, J-Query, ANGULAR JS, MVC 4 or 5, HTML 5, BOOTSTRAP, Microsoft Office.
- Must demonstrate great awareness of web security techniques Must use a Version Control system such as Git and Mercurial (or be willing to learn).
Method of Application
Interested and qualified? Go to Snapnet Limited on forms.microsoft.com to apply